PSL 9: Wasim Jr reflects on guidance provided by Mohammad Amir at Quetta Gladiators

                            The 22-year-old is playing his first season with Quetta

Mohammad Wasim Jr (L) and Mohammad Amir (R). - PCBISLAMABAD: All-rounder Mohammad Wasim Jr opened up about the invaluable guidance provided by former Pakistan pacer Mohammad Amir during his stint with the Quetta Gladiators in the ongoing Pakistan Super League (PSL) season nine.Reflecting on his experience, Wasim Jr highlighted Amir's consistent guidance on bowling strategies. "Amir consistently guides bowling strategies, emphasising the importance of taking wickets. His confidence adds value to our bowling efforts.
	
		
	
"Bowling in Pakistan requires more than just pace; having skills is essential," he added.Acknowledging the challenges of playing in the PSL as an emerging player, Wasim Jr stressed the significance of delivering standout performances in the league to secure a coveted place in the Pakistan national team. 
    
"Delivering performances in the PSL is crucial for securing a place in the Pakistan national team for new players. The environment in Quetta Gladiators is excellent; it's a new team," he added.Identifying himself as an all-rounder, Wasim Jr expressed his commitment to contributing in both batting and bowling. "I consider myself as a bowling all-rounder, I try to contribute in both batting and bowling. I adapt my game according to the team's situation," he maintained."In addition to being fast, having variations in skills is crucial. I don't consider myself specifically a specialist in Pakistan's conditions.
